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
630 9273347 801795800
706556 903115412
706556 903115412
72810280555 00282231 75664512
All about undefined
Interested in learning more?
706556 903115412
72810280555 00282231 75664512
See more
4399836 1808007784 0292415
64503174 80 45926889314
See more
16674914148 76
61268 265073122 52
See more